Understanding Inverter Repair Challenges in North Korea

North Korea's limited access to international spare parts and specialized technicians makes inverter repairs uniquely complex. Common issues include:

  • Voltage instability due to aging grid infrastructure
  • Component corrosion in coastal regions (e.g., Nampo and Wonsan)
  • Compatibility issues with solar hybrid systems
